How Far From Pomeroy to ...

We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ers & Almanacs that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Pomeroy to various places of note, such as the White House.

With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ance beginning in Pomeroy and extending to:

  • West Chester, which is the Seat of Chester County, lies 14 miles [22.5 km]<3> to the east. If you could walk a straight line from Pomeroy to West Chester, with an average speed<5>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take most of a day to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take four to five hours.
  • Harrisburg, which is the State Capital of Pennsylvania, lies 57 miles [91.7 km] to the west northwest (WNW).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take less than an hour, a buggy would take over two days and walking would take most of three days.
  • The White House (Washington, DC) is 95 miles [152.9 km] to the southwest (SW). Driving would take less than two hours, a buggy would take three full days and walking would take 6 days.

<6>The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Pomeroy to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.Our distance measurements begin at a specific point in Pomeroy.
